Influence of Sunshine Strength



Often, the strength of sunlight can considerably affect the efficiency of solar panels. When the sunlight is strong and direct, your solar panels create more electricity. However, during cloudy days or when the sun is at a reduced angle, the panels obtain less sunlight, lowering their efficiency. To optimize the power result of your photovoltaic panels, it's essential to mount them in locations with ample sunlight exposure throughout the day. Consider variables like shielding from nearby trees or structures that can obstruct sunlight and decrease the panels' performance.

To enhance the performance of your photovoltaic panels, regularly clean them to eliminate any kind of dirt, dirt, or particles that might be blocking sunshine absorption. Role of Cloud Cover and Rainfall



Cloud cover and rains can considerably impact the effectiveness of solar panels. When clouds block the sun, the amount of sunlight reaching your photovoltaic panels is minimized, leading to a decrease in power production. Rainfall can likewise impact photovoltaic panel efficiency by obstructing sunlight and creating a layer of dust or crud on the panels, better decreasing their ability to generate electrical power. Even light rainfall can spread sunlight, triggering it to be less concentrated on the panels.



Throughout cloudy days with hefty cloud cover, solar panels might experience a substantial drop in energy result. However, it deserves keeping in mind that some modern-day photovoltaic panel innovations can still generate electrical power even when the sky is cloudy. In addition, rain can have a cleaning impact on solar panels, getting rid of dirt and dirt that may have built up in time.
